Compartilhar via


Método DataParameter.TryConvertValue

Tenta converter o valor especificado para o tipo especificado.

Namespace:  Microsoft.VisualStudio.Data
Assembly:  Microsoft.VisualStudio.Data (em Microsoft.VisualStudio.Data.dll)

Sintaxe

'Declaração
Protected Overridable Function TryConvertValue ( _
    value As Object, _
    type As String _
) As Object
protected virtual Object TryConvertValue(
    Object value,
    string type
)
protected:
virtual Object^ TryConvertValue(
    Object^ value, 
    String^ type
)
abstract TryConvertValue : 
        value:Object * 
        type:string -> Object 
override TryConvertValue : 
        value:Object * 
        type:string -> Object 
protected function TryConvertValue(
    value : Object, 
    type : String
) : Object

Parâmetros

Valor de retorno

Tipo: System.Object
Retorna o valor convertido, ou retorna nulluma referência nula (Nothing no Visual Basic) se nenhuma conversão foi possível.

Comentários

Este método é chamado pela implementação base de OnTypeChanged para tentar converter todo o valor do parâmetro atualmente definido para o novo tipo.O método deve tratar todas as entrada de valor, incluindo Value e nulluma referência nula (Nothing no Visual Basic).

Em o caso de DBNull, o método deve retornar somente DBNull é o valor convertido.Em o caso de nulluma referência nula (Nothing no Visual Basic), deve retornar nulluma referência nula (Nothing no Visual Basic).

A implementação base de esse método trata os exemplos de DBNull e retorna nulluma referência nula (Nothing no Visual Basic) para todos os outros casos.

Segurança do .NET Framework

Consulte também

Referência

DataParameter Classe

Namespace Microsoft.VisualStudio.Data